CAAP'S Longhouse is a meeting place to share stories, news, skills, ideas and wisdom. Its aim is to foster a resilient Asian Australian performance community. In 2019 we're thrilled to announce a program that extends to Perth and Melbourne.
SYDNEY
LONGHOUSE 1 : How to Get Your Work Up
Aimed at aspiring content creators in the Asian Australian performance community join our panel for a discussion about pathways and opportunities to get your work shown. With:
- Melissa Lee Speyer - playwright and screenwriter and recipient of the Foxtel Diversity Scholarship
- Pearl Tan - founder and director of Pearly Productions, Senior Lecturer in Directing, Australian Film Television and Radio School (AFTRS)
- Genevieve Craig - actor, writer, producer and creator of web series Chikas
- Facilitated by actor, dramaturg and director Courtney Stewart
THU 4 JULY | 6PM - 8PM | CARRIAGEWORKS | $15 + bf
LONGHOUSE 2: The Pitch
A producing hothouse of sorts, THE PITCH gives you access to some of Sydney’s most revered producers who will break down the process of producing and pitching new works for stage and screen.

LONGHOUSE 3 : Works in Progress Showcase
Join us for the final Longhouse of 2019 – the annual CAAP Works-In-Progress showcase featuring some of the freshest works in development by Asian Australian artists.

PERTH
We welcome artists from the west into the CAAP community in this very first Longhouse to be held in partnership with Black Swan State Theatre Company. Facilitated by Joe Lui this promises to be a lively and provocative panel discussion about the experiences of Asian Australian artists in WA.
MON 12 AUG | 6.30PM - 8.30PM | STATE THEATRE CENTRE OF WA
MELBOURNE
We return to Melbourne Theatre Company's Lawler Theatre for the second Longhouse: Melbourne, timed to coincide with their season of Golden Shield by exciting Asian Australian playwright Anchuli Felicia King.
THU 5 SEP | 6PM - 8PM | LAWLER THEATRE
